Before you go to that effort, try doing the following as root:

    # cd /dev
    # ./MAKEDEV usb

That should create a /dev/usb tree with a bunch of devices. Then try
rebooting and see what happens. (My usb scanner is mapped to
/dev/usb/scanner0)
